·async-programming
</>

async-programming

Параллельные операции с asyncio и Tokio с упором на предотвращение гонок, безопасность ресурсов и производительность.

88Установки·0Тренд·@martinholovsky

Установка

$npx skills add https://github.com/martinholovsky/claude-skills-generator --skill async-programming

Как установить async-programming

Быстро установите AI-навык async-programming в вашу среду разработки через командную строку

  1. Откройте терминал: Откройте терминал или инструмент командной строки (Terminal, iTerm, Windows Terminal и т.д.)
  2. Выполните команду установки: Скопируйте и выполните эту команду: npx skills add https://github.com/martinholovsky/claude-skills-generator --skill async-programming
  3. Проверьте установку: После установки навык будет автоматически настроен в вашей AI-среде разработки и готов к использованию в Claude Code, Cursor или OpenClaw

Источник: martinholovsky/claude-skills-generator.

Justification: Async programming introduces race conditions, resource leaks, and timing-based vulnerabilities. While not directly exposed to external attacks, improper async code can cause data corruption, deadlocks, and security-sensitive race conditions like double-spending or TOCTOU (time-of-check-time-of-use).

You are an expert in asynchronous programming patterns for Python (asyncio) and Rust (Tokio). You write concurrent code that is free from race conditions, properly manages resources, and handles errors gracefully.

| Shared mutable state | Use asyncio.Lock or RwLock | | Database transaction | Use atomic operations, SELECT FOR UPDATE | | Resource cleanup | Use async context managers | | Task coordination | Use asyncio.Event, Queue, or Semaphore | | Background tasks | Track tasks, handle cancellation |

Параллельные операции с asyncio и Tokio с упором на предотвращение гонок, безопасность ресурсов и производительность. Источник: martinholovsky/claude-skills-generator.

Факты (для цитирования)

Стабильные поля и команды для ссылок в AI/поиске.

Команда установки
npx skills add https://github.com/martinholovsky/claude-skills-generator --skill async-programming
Категория
</>Разработка
Проверено
Впервые замечено
2026-02-01
Обновлено
2026-03-10

Browse more skills from martinholovsky/claude-skills-generator

Короткие ответы

Что такое async-programming?

Параллельные операции с asyncio и Tokio с упором на предотвращение гонок, безопасность ресурсов и производительность. Источник: martinholovsky/claude-skills-generator.

Как установить async-programming?

Откройте терминал или инструмент командной строки (Terminal, iTerm, Windows Terminal и т.д.) Скопируйте и выполните эту команду: npx skills add https://github.com/martinholovsky/claude-skills-generator --skill async-programming После установки навык будет автоматически настроен в вашей AI-среде разработки и готов к использованию в Claude Code, Cursor или OpenClaw

Где находится исходный репозиторий?

https://github.com/martinholovsky/claude-skills-generator

Детали

Категория
</>Разработка
Источник
skills.sh
Впервые замечено
2026-02-01